Ilia Delio: A Cyborg Christian on the God Revolution We Need Now
from Sounds True: Insights at the Edge
What if the God you've been taught to believe in is the very thing that’s keeping you from finding God? Tami Simon speaks with Sister Ilia Delio—Franciscan theologian, scientist, and author of The Not Yet God—about the evolutionary vision of Teilhard de Chardin, why monotheism is giving way to a new religious consciousness, and how AI, far from threatening our humanity, might be the unexpected catalyst for a God revolution.This conversation offers genuine transmission—not just concepts about awakening, but the palpable presence of realized teachers exploring the growing edge of spiritual understanding together.
